On the strength of his late-season running, Baylor RB Lache Seastrunk has been named as the Big 12 Offensive Newcomer of the Year.

This award is given in contrast to the Big 12 Offensive Freshman of the Year, which was Oklahoma State's J.W. Walsh. Seastrunk transferred to Baylor before last season, sat out when his petition for immediate eligibility was denied, and then played in every game this season, receiving most of his playing time in the last five games. In those games, he's been phenomenal, averaging over 7 yards per carry and positioning himself for a 1,000 yard rushing season with a strong performance in the Holiday Bowl against UCLA.
